Transaction 943212d63d567f74c42d3034462e9d48968642155d114fe20e44b7320323bbbf
1 Input
2 Outputs
- 943212d63d567f74c42d3034462e9d48968642155d114fe20e44b7320323bbbf:0
- 943212d63d567f74c42d3034462e9d48968642155d114fe20e44b7320323bbbf:1
value 414785700
address 13bbgfFh94mE9NaMfsZdwwyPMXL3ERHajG
value 496314000
address 1EY9LsFo7p1qaWWntUNBgxt8SvagB19ejn